HEATERS AND MANUAL AIR CONDITIONING
9. REMOVAL OF CONDENSER
Move the radiator toward the engine, and then remove the
condenser upward.
INSPECTION
Check the condenser fan for crushing or other damage.

Check the condenser fan shroud for damage.

SERVICE POINT OF INSTALLATION
9. INSTALLATION OF CONDENSER
If a new condenser is used, fill it with the specified amount
of compressor oil before installing on the vehicle.
Compressor oil: SUN PAG 56
Quantity: 15 cm3 (.5 fl.oz.)
